As dogs age, memory, mobility, and emotional behavior changes can become more apparent. These shifts may happen gradually and affect how pets interact with their environment, family members, and daily routines. Owners seek ways to support these transitions with a focus on gentle, natural care that suits the needs of older pets.
Nutritional products designed for later life stages have gained attention among pet owners. These products combine calming herbs and functional ingredients to support mental clarity and ease. Senior dog supplements are one approach used to help promote comfort and balanced behavior in aging dogs.

1. Lion’s Mane Supports Mental Alertness
Lion’s Mane is a mushroom recognized for its possible role in supporting healthy brain activity. This ingredient has been linked to nerve cell communication, which may help maintain memory and attention in older dogs. It supports focus, interaction, and a more alert mind throughout the day.
2. Reishi Helps with Calmness and Immune Stability
Reishi is known for its traditional use in maintaining emotional balance and supporting the immune system. Senior dogs may benefit from this mushroom during periods of stress or environmental change. Its properties are usually included in wellness routines that provide gentle emotional support while reinforcing general health.
3. Cordyceps Contributes to Gentle Energy Support
Cordyceps is used to promote healthy stamina and energy levels. It may assist senior dogs who appear tired or slow to engage in daily activity. Supporting respiratory and adrenal function helps aging pets remain more comfortable during physical exertion and daily movement.
4. Ashwagandha Supports Emotional and Nervous Health
Ashwagandha is an herb used for its calming qualities. It is generally included in care routines for pets showing restlessness or discomfort in changing situations. For aging dogs, Ashwagandha may help maintain a balanced emotional state and support the nervous system’s response to mild stress.
5. Bacopa Monnieri Helps Maintain Cognitive Focus
Bacopa Monnieri is a plant used to support memory and mental clarity. In senior dogs, it may assist with focus and help reduce signs of disinterest or distraction. This ingredient is chosen for routines centered on cognitive wellness and ongoing mental support throughout aging.
6. Glycerin-Based Formulas Improve Digestive Comfort
Older dogs can have specific preferences regarding texture and taste. Glycerin-based liquid options simplify administration, particularly for dogs with sensitive digestion or selective eating habits. These formulas usually mix easily with food, allowing consistent use without creating resistance or discomfort during meals.
7. CBD Offers Calm and Relief from Everyday Discomfort
CBD (cannabidiol) is a naturally occurring compound derived from hemp that has become popular in pet wellness. It may help ease joint stiffness, support calm behavior, and reduce signs of anxiety in senior dogs. When used regularly, CBD can offer gentle relief and improve overall comfort during rest or activity.
8. Full-Spectrum CBD Supports the Endocannabinoid System
Full-spectrum CBD includes a range of beneficial hemp compounds that work together to support the body’s natural balance. In aging dogs, this may help regulate sleep, appetite, mood, and immune responses. Many pet owners include CBD in daily routines to promote a steady emotional state and enhance their dog’s quality of life as they age.
Thoughtful Formulations Offer More Well-Rounded Support
Today’s wellness products for aging dogs are usually designed to focus on gentle, natural support that mitigates canine disease risk. Rather than relying on synthetic additives, many formulations prioritize clean, purposeful ingredients that are known to suit older pets' needs. These blends aim to support mental clarity and emotional balance through well-researched combinations.
Standard features of well-rounded formulations include:
● Functional mushrooms such as Lion’s Mane or Reishi for cognitive and immune health
● Herbs like Ashwagandha and Bacopa for emotional calm and memory support
● Plant-based carriers, such as vegetable glycerin, for easier digestion and daily use
These thoughtfully prepared products strongly emphasize purity, transparency, and long-term wellness.
